Ad verification from Netherlands: what changes
Choosing the right proxy setup is less about the biggest package and more about matching trust, speed, and location to the job. Running ad verification against Netherlands targets means media buyers verifying ad placement and regional creative need exits that behave like local Dutch users, so see ads the way real visitors in each market see them.
Netherlands routes consumer traffic mainly through ISPs such as KPN, Ziggo, and Odido, with mobile coverage from carriers like KPN, Vodafone, and Odido. Prices are quoted in EUR (€) and most public pages localise content by dutch language and region. Amsterdam hosts AMS-IX, one of the world's largest internet exchanges, and is a top-tier European data-center and cloud connectivity hub; GDPR applies nationwide.
Why the Netherlands location matters for ad verification
In ad verification, the usual targets are publisher pages, landing pages, ad slots, and tracking redirects. From a Dutch IP those pages return region-correct language, currency, and availability. The main risks are cloaked creatives, blocked geos, and inconsistent device targeting, which get worse when the exit location and the content locale disagree.
Best proxy type for ad verification in Netherlands
For this workload in Netherlands, residential proxies are a sensible default because they make requests look like ordinary household browsing. Blend in other types when the target gets stricter.
| Proxy type | Use in Netherlands when |
|---|---|
| Residential | Trust matters and targets localise heavily |
| ISP / static | You need stable Dutch sessions for logins or carts |
| Datacenter | The target is tolerant and volume is high |
| Mobile / 4G-5G | The target is mobile-first or very sensitive |
Workflow for ad verification in Netherlands
The working pattern is: select the market, load the page with realistic headers, record creative evidence, and compare against campaign settings. Track verified impressions by market beside every Dutch result so you can explain differences between markets. Run at campaign launch and spot checks and keep a backup exit ready.
